Warning: conflict of interest, instance of nepotism. This is my pal’s place, and since she so kindly gave us her insights into life in New Paltz, we decided to show it to you. Liz says the house, built in 1999, is amazing, wonderful, a revelation, close to town…and just too big for her family of three. So they’re looking to downsize.
If you, however, are looking to upsize, here’s what you’ll get: “4 bedrooms, 5 baths, finished recreation room, a second sunroom with soaring, sky lit ceiling, and a gourmet kitchen with granite counters joining the spacious breakfast area.” Space, indeed, with over 4,000 square feet. And nice views. Close to town. Taxes: over $16,000, which is a common problem with real estate around these parts.
